Description

Rich and Fudgy Brownies.

Ingredients

  • ½ cups Butter
  • 4 ounces, weight Semisweet Chocolate
  • ¾ cups Brown Sugar
  • ¼ cups Sugar
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la
  • 2 whole Eggs
  • 6 Tablespoons Flour
  • 2 Tablespoons Cocoa Powder
  • ¼ teaspoons Salt

Preparation

Preheat oven to 350ºF. Prepare an 8″ baking pan with butter and flour.

Melt the butter and chocolate together in the microwave. Cool slightly. Stir in the brown sugar, sugar and vanilla. Beat in the eggs until light and fluffy. Add the flour, cocoa powder, and salt and stir until just combined, being careful not to over-mix.

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ake until the brownies are set in the middle, about 30 minutes.
